Supreme People's Court Addresses 469 Deputies' Suggestions

The Supreme People's Court said on Thursday it addressed 469 suggestions from deputies at the third session of the 14th National People's Congress in 2025, up nearly 30% from 361 in 2024. The court prioritized proposals on child protection, intellectual property, telecom fraud and high-quality development and engaged deputies through feedback, visits and published landmark cases. The moves signal increased judicial responsiveness to public concerns.
